Protected by a clutter of green plants in pots, it is a trattoria pure juice, with its old sofas like at the mamma's, a TV connected to Italian channels, an everlasting smell of pasta and pizza... The dishes are chosen à la carte or on the slate, the service is (sometimes) slow, but nice, some tables are nice at night on a wooden deck and it's a real treat in a talkative and good-natured atmosphere. Not necessarily the best Italian restaurant in the area, but does very well when the Botteghita, the Voglia Matta or 1974 are full
